Summary

Pulumi ESC (Environments, Secrets, and Configuration) enhances infrastructure and application management by offering centralized secrets management and configuration orchestration, featuring a newly redesigned onboarding experience and automated setup as an OpenID Connect (OIDC) provider. This update simplifies the process of managing configurations for Pulumi programs and handling secret rotation, while also centralizing secrets across multiple providers. Pulumi ESC can issue short-lived, signed tokens for temporary cloud credentials, improving security by eliminating the need for hard-coded credentials. The onboarding now includes an automated OIDC setup for AWS, Azure, and Google Cloud, allowing users to log in with cloud credentials and let Pulumi Cloud manage the setup process, streamlining the creation of ESC environments. This initiative is part of ongoing efforts to simplify the setup and onboarding process, making it easier for teams to configure, secure, and manage environments effectively.
